Class Central is learner-supported. When you buy through links on our site, we may earn an affiliate commission.

Udemy

HTML5 Canvas Ultimate Guide

via Udemy

Overview

Most powerful drawings, animations, web applications and games with HTML5 Canvas by using JavaScript

What you'll learn:
  • Learning basics of HTML5 Canvas
  • Advanced skills of drawing on Canvas
  • Able to build HTML5 games with Canvas
  • Display data on Canvas
  • Animations and Transitions on Canvas
  • Clear and solid understandings of Canvas

*** The most comprehensiveHTML5 Canvas Course in Udemy! ***

*** Real English Captions (not auto-generated) ***

Canvas was initially created by Apple in 2004 and it has been going on to shape the modern next generationweb applications. In today's modern web development world, it is one of the most demanding skills to create games, web graphics, drawings and data visualizations without any plugin like old Flash-dependent days.

In this course, we will cover all of the key points of the Canvas API together. This course is a best chance for whom is willing to learn this edge technology or improve personal skills set. Every topics are supported by comprehensive html canvas examples,projects and lab sessions to support andreinforce the learning curve.

The topic covered in the course are mainly :

  • Basics of Canvas

  • Understanding the basic math behind canvas and coordinate systems

  • Drawing paths and lines on canvas

  • Drawing shapes like rect, circle and more complex polygons

  • Writing texts on canvas

  • Text effects

  • Displaying images on canvas

  • Playing videos on canvas

  • Transformations

  • Animations

  • DOM interactions

  • Events

Let's dive into the Canvas ocean together!

If you have any questions related to the lectures, do not hesitate to ask!


javascript canvas library, html canvas image, html5 canvas examples with source code, canvas developer guide, canvas api github, canvas api java, canvas api assignments, canvas api live

Syllabus

  • Introduction
  • Drawing Lines and Paths on Canvas
  • Drawing Shapes on Canvas
  • Drawing Texts on Canvas
  • Project : Building a Open Source Bar Chart Library
  • Drawing Images on Canvas
  • Canvas Advanced Topics
  • Animations
  • Transformations on Canvas
  • Making Physics with Animations on Canvas
  • User Interactions on Canvas
  • Project : Building a Flappy Monster Game
  • Project : Building Paint Application
  • End of Journey

Taught by

Alperen Talaslıoğlu

Reviews

4.4 rating at Udemy based on 467 ratings

Start your review of HTML5 Canvas Ultimate Guide

Never Stop Learning.

Get personalized course recommendations, track subjects and courses with reminders, and more.

Someone learning on their laptop while sitting on the floor.